01510627730 Summary (Read all comments)

Phone number ☎️ 01510627730 👆 is reported as a scam call pretending to be from HM Revenue and Customs. Callers claim theres a revenue fraud issue and urge you to press a button to speak to an advisor, but its not genuine. Many users note the call is automated and attempts to trick people into revealing personal info or money. Overall, its a common phishing scam that tries to sound official but should be treated with caution.

About 01 Numbers

These numbers correspond to specific locations in the UK and are widely used by both residences and businesses.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are contingent on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that grant free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with many plans providing these numbers in their free call packages.
